Lies that bind: Uganda’s anti-gay law turns refugee camps into prisons for fake gay asylum seekers

Lies that bind: Uganda’s anti-gay law turns refugee camps into prisons for fake gay asylum seekers

Engaging in homosexual acts can now result in a life sentence and attempting to have same-sex relations can earn a 10-year prison term. There is even the death penalty for “aggravated homosexuality”, which includes same-sex relationships with HIV-positive people, and up to 14 years in prison for “attempted aggravated homosexuality”.

Free speech: In wake of Covid lies peddled by drug companies, global ‘thought crime’ legislation is doomed to fail

Free speech: In wake of Covid lies peddled by drug companies, global ‘thought crime’ legislation is doomed to fail

“Disinformation” is defined in dictionaries as information that is intended to mislead and cause harm. “Misinformation” has no such intent and is just an error, but even then that means determining what is in the author’s mind. “Mal-information” is considered to be something that is true, but that there is an intention to cause harm.
